Why is credco on my credit report?
CoreLogic Credco is a third-party consumer credit reporting agency that provides merged credit reports to a number of mortgage lenders. So a CREDCO inquiry on your credit reports could simply mean that you recently applied for a mortgage with a lender that relies on CoreLogic Credco for its credit-report needs.

Who uses credco Auto?
Mortgage lenders and auto lenders are steady customers of CoreLogic CREDCO. So, if you recently applied for a pre-qual on a mortgage for example, you will likely see the CREDCO on your credit report rather than one or more of the three consumer reporting agencies—Experian, Equifax, and Transunion.

Does Wells Fargo use credco?
If not provided at the time the Credit Package is submitted for underwriting, Wells Fargo Funding will obtain a credit report from CoreLogic Credco or Equifax prior to underwriting the file. This Loan Score will be used to determine pricing and Loan eligibility.
What credit score do you need for Quicken Loans?
Minimum Credit Score for FHA Loans. The minimum FICO score for an FHA loan through Quicken Loans is 580, with a 3.5% minimum down payment. Other lenders may have different requirements. For a standard FHA loan , a minimum of one credit score is required to qualify.
